Episode 87: Bethan & Dan - Finding Modern Jive as a New Hobby Together

from Jive Buddies · host Ton Voon & Paul Jeffery

We met a cheeky married couple early in their dance journey, and wanted to know what made them go (spoiler: Tiktok!), what their first class was like, and how it fits into the rest of their social life.
